Cut the chicken breast into 1-inch cubes and set aside.
In a large mixing bowl, combine olive oil, lemon juice, minced garlic, ground cumin, ground coriander, paprika, dried oregano, ground black pepper, and salt. Whisk the marinade until well blended.
Add the chicken cubes to the marinade, ensuring all pieces are well-coated.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, or up to overnight for more flavor.
While the chicken marinates, soak wooden skewers in water for at least 30 minutes to prevent burning, if using wooden skewers.
Cut the bell pepper and red onion into 1-inch pieces.
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
Thread the marinated chicken, bell peppers, and red onion onto the skewers, alternating each ingredient.
Place the kebabs on the grill and cook for about 12-15 minutes, turning occasionally, until the chicken is cooked through and has nice grill marks.
Remove from the grill and transfer to a serving platter.
Garnish with chopped fresh parsley before serving.
